Susanna Tapani scored on a breakaway with just 47 seconds remaining in overtime to give the Boston Fleet a 3-2 win over the Ottawa Charge in Professional Women’s Hockey League action on Thursday night.
The Charge dominated play in the overtime period but Tapani broke free in her own end and outskated Ottawa’s defenders before beating Emerance Maschmeyer.
Tereza Vanisova tied the game for the Charge with 2.9 seconds left in the third period after Ronja Savolainen scored the first Charge goal. That came at 16:37 of the third period to cut the Fleet lead to 2-1.
There were some other fireworks in the third period. With eight minutes to play in the game, the fists were flying and several punches landed between Vanisova and Boston’s Jill Saulnier, but at the end of the battle, the combatants were handed just a roughing minor each.
